Output ef850be7aefe20e6e0ea034dfa750a5c4e5adcbf96a4e63f65876f18db93e537:3

value
59736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c7552edf8bd7e6d247fb25dc8193db84a6abfec OP_EQUAL
address
3Mnh8ZFshsNg8UFrjZEDujatront5G4qtM
transaction
ef850be7aefe20e6e0ea034dfa750a5c4e5adcbf96a4e63f65876f18db93e537
confirmations
1793
spent
true